Motor
In the STR ETV/ETD range all motors have the same diameter. More
powerful motors are made longer.
Focus has been to increase the robustness of the motor. For example the
bearing houses are made stronger and in Aluminum. A new insulation
system has made it possible for the intermediate shaft to be made with
fewer parts and without plastic material.
Motor rotation speed is higher than on ST tools when running with a Power
Focus 6000.

Torque transducer
The torque transducer is a delicate part that should not be replaced if faulty.
The transducer shows a very accurate reading from 100% down to 20% of
the nominal torque. STR range is improved so that disturbance from the
motor has less effect on the signal, making the reading more exact resulting
in an improved tool accuracy.
Gears and Angle head
Planet gears and angle gears are all made of a special steel that is specially
developed for Atlas Copco.
The angle head gears are spiral cut for maximum accuracy and durability,
larger angle heads are prepared for attaching a reaction plate.
ETT front part
The ETT front part differs from other tools in how the transducer is placed
after the angle gear and attached to the output shaft. This gives the ETT tools
an accuracy of 2,5% over 3s.
Accessories (attached to the tool (ETV/ETD))
The tool has two connections for accessories, making it possible to combine
a number of different combinations of helpful accessories.
Accessory Function
Lever trigger 135deg
Trigger that is offset for alternative grip, acting as
“button”.
Lever trigger?
Same as lever trigger 135 deg but straight, acting as
“button”
Button Button for sending impulse on st bus.
Headlight Lamp to illuminate tolls work area.
2D scanner Scanning 2d codes (3d > qr)
Selector ring (button) Button on ring, acting as “button”
Tool leds Led card with leds to send operator feedback.
Ehmi Display with 3 buttons
